Righteous anger is when you vent your frustration and anger to everyone and anyone BUT the person who can do something about it.
For example ... If you are annoyed with service at a restaurant .. who do you complain to? Your friends,
family, the parking guard? If you are complaining to anyone but the waiter, manager or someone at the
restaurant who can do something then you are using your anger to use it to manipulate people or make
yourself feel powerful. This is a cheap trick which ends badly. Learn to express yourself appropriately and in a healthy way that does not sabotage your relationships.
